The Growing Threat of Crypto Scams

Crypto scams are no longer limited to fake emails or suspicious links. Today’s scammers use advanced tactics such as:

  • Fake crypto investment platforms
  • Impersonation of legitimate companies
  • Social media and WhatsApp trading groups
  • Rug pulls and pump-and-dump schemes
  • Romance and trust-based financial manipulation

Regulatory authorities in the USA (FTC), UK (FCA), Canada (CSA), and Australia (ASIC) have all reported a sharp increase in crypto-related fraud cases. Unfortunately, once funds are transferred to a scammer’s wallet, transactions are irreversible—making recovery complex but not always impossible.

Can Stolen Cryptocurrency Be Recovered?

While cryptocurrency transactions are irreversible by design, blockchain technology is transparent. Every transaction is recorded permanently on the blockchain. With the right forensic tools and expertise, professionals can:

  • Trace crypto wallet movements
  • Identify linked addresses
  • Track exchanges used for cash-outs
  • Gather digital evidence for legal proceedings

What To Do Immediately After a Crypto Scam

If you suspect you’ve been scammed:

  1. Stop all communication with the scammer
  2. Save all transaction IDs, wallet addresses, and communication records
  3. Report the incident to your local financial authority
  4. Contact a reputable crypto recovery service for evaluation
  5. Avoid “recovery scams” promising instant refunds

Time is critical in crypto scam recovery. The sooner blockchain tracing begins, the better the chances of identifying fund movement patterns.
